Getting a haircut when you don't know the local language well by robotisland in solotravel

[–]sikhster 0 points1 point  (0 children)

If you have any photos of yourself after a haircut you like, bring those. Have your current barber write out instructions and put that through Google translate. Also you might be surprised by the amount of barbers who speak English.

Questions about visiting the US by Arimodu in USTravel

[–]sikhster 0 points1 point  (0 children)

I’m an American and I use cards everywhere except taco trucks and marijuana dispensaries. 95% of my transactions happen on my credit cards. Even with a debit card, you can charge your transactions as “credit” so you don’t have to use your PIN. I bring that up as a safer option. In terms of finding steakhouses, The Infatuation (online site) is a good place to start, as well as Yelp and Google Maps. For driving, I’ve heard mixed things about Texas but keep pace with traffic and maintain distance from other cars.
